インターフェースの使用
org.springframework.data.util.TypeScanner
パッケージ
説明
Ahead of Time コンパイルの実行時に、リフレクション、リソース、java 直列化、プロキシの必要性を登録するためのサポート。
ジェネリクス型を解決するための型情報フレームワークなどのコアユーティリティ API。
org.springframework.data.aot 内の TypeScanner 使用
修飾子と型メソッド説明default TypeScanner
AotContext.getTypeScanner()
AOT 処理インフラストラクチャに提供されるtypes
SE をスキャンするために使用される新しいTypeScanner
を返します。org.springframework.data.util 内の TypeScanner 使用
修飾子と型メソッド説明default TypeScanner
TypeScanner.forTypesAnnotatedWith
(ClassSE<? extends AnnotationSE>... annotations) スキャン結果に含める型を識別するアノテーションを定義します。TypeScanner.forTypesAnnotatedWith
(CollectionSE<ClassSE<? extends AnnotationSE>> annotations) スキャン結果に含める型を識別するアノテーションを定義します。TypeScanner.onClassNotFound
(ConsumerSE<ClassNotFoundExceptionSE> action) ClassNotFoundException
SE の場合に何が起こるかを定義します。default TypeScanner
TypeScanner.scanPackages
(StringSE... packageNames) スキャンするパッケージのnames
SE を収集します。TypeScanner.scanPackages
(CollectionSE<StringSE> packageNames) スキャンするパッケージのnames
SE を収集します。static TypeScanner
TypeScanner.typeScanner
(ClassLoaderSE classLoader) 指定されたClassLoader
SE を使用して新しいTypeScanner
を作成します。static TypeScanner
TypeScanner.typeScanner
(ApplicationContext context) 指定されたApplicationContext
を使用して新しいTypeScanner
を作成します。static TypeScanner
TypeScanner.typeScanner
(ResourceLoader resourceLoader) 指定されたResourceLoader
を使用して新しいTypeScanner
を作成します。